Job Description:

Territory focus: South Yorkshire

The role:

A great opportunity to be part of a market-leading organisation within the Healthcare space, focused on Diabetes and selling a hugely successful product range.

The Territory Manager will be expected to:

  • Engage with KOLs, HCPs and key decisionmakers within the target health boards to drive product advocacy and uptake across territory.
  • Deliver account/business plans to further increase product sales.
  • Maximise formulary status/pull-through and implement patient pathways.
  • Provide education and product training to HCPs and patients, further driving awareness of the product range.

Please note that you must live on territory to be considered for this role.

Key skills and experience required:

  • Existing pharmaceutical or medical device sales experience within Diabetes.
  • Strong communications skills with the ability to confidently engage with, and influence, customers.
  • Time management and account planning ability.
  • Experience of collaborating with cross-functional teams.
